Yellowjackets Season 3 Episode 6 Explores Survival, Trauma, and Shocking Decisions

The episode delves into moral dilemmas, escalating tensions, and a pivotal death that deepens the psychological and supernatural undertones of the series.

  • Coach Ben's death marks a turning point as the Yellowjackets confront moral and survival-driven decisions in the wilderness.
  • The episode highlights the group's shift from survival-based cannibalism to ritualistic practices, signaling a darker evolution in their behavior.
  • In the present timeline, the survivors are drawn together by a mysterious tape that threatens to expose their past and deepen their shared trauma.
  • The introduction of new characters in the wilderness timeline raises questions about potential rescue and the group's secrecy about their actions.
  • Tensions rise among the survivors as supernatural elements and fractured relationships continue to blur the line between reality and delusion.
